MACEDON, Kingdom of, Alexander III, (336-323 B.C.), silver tetradrachm, (17.05 g), Babylon II mint, issued c.311-300 B.C. issued under Seleukos I Nikator, obv. head of Herakles to right wearing lion skin, rev. Zeus Aetophoros seated on throne to left, eagle in outstretched hand, in exergue **BASILEWS*, upright anchor and A to left, **ALEXANDROU* to right, M below throne, (cf.S.6713, Price 3359 (Arados), SC 94.11b, BMC 3359a-b, M.1511, Newell WSM Pl.xliv, A, HGC 9, 10g). Very fine, scarce.

Ex Colin E. Pitchfork Collection, and from CNG eSale 424, 11 July 2018 (lot 248), and previously from Mail Bid Sale 41, 19 March 1997, (lot 301).

Ex Noble Numismatics Sale 78 (lot 4971) and Sale 99 (lot 3633).
